The RGB color code for color number #483337 is RGB(72, 51, 55). In the RGB color model, #483337 has a red value of 72, a green value of 51, and a blue value of 55. The CMYK color model (also known as process color, used in color printing) comprises 0.0% cyan, 29.2% magenta, 23.6% yellow, and 71.8% key (black). The HSL color scale has a hue of 348.6° (degrees), 17.1 % saturation, and 24.1 % lightness. In the HSB/HSV color space, #483337 has a hue of 348.6° (degrees), 29.2 % saturation and 28.2 % brightness/value.
Color 483337 is cool or warm?
Color 483337 is a warm color.
What is the LRV of 483337?
Color code 483337 has an LRV of nearly 4.
By LRV value, it is a very dark color.
Light Reflectance Value (LRV), indicates how light or dark a color will look on a scale of 0 (black) to 100 (white).
